Output 53f981c9a87aba49e80509f317171cfc323f2996d5b0dc6d26601f8971727e0f:18

value
6323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82424830829baa45458a89f92f8a92f533b6989e OP_EQUAL
address
3DZmAqPcc1ZrpSyYNnMsDBGuuXBaFpAs8D
transaction
53f981c9a87aba49e80509f317171cfc323f2996d5b0dc6d26601f8971727e0f
spent
true